Jane C. Waldbaum Archaeological Field School Scholarship (March 1, 2024)

Sara Sader by Sara Sader
January 30, 2024
Jane C. Waldbaum Archaeological Field School Scholarship

Offered by
The Archaeological Institute of America (AIA)

Amount
$1,000

Deadline
 March 1, 2024

Established to honor AIA Honorary President Jane Waldbaum, this scholarship aims to assist students embarking on their initial foray into archaeological fieldwork. Particularly, students majoring in archaeology or related disciplines are urged to submit their applications. The scholarship fund serves to cover expenses linked to participation in archaeological fieldwork projects, requiring a minimum stay of one month or four weeks.

Eligibility for this scholarship extends to students who have initiated their junior year of undergraduate studies during the application period and have not yet completed their initial year of graduate school at a U.S. or Canadian college or university. Prospective applicants must be at least 18 years old and should lack prior experience in any form of archaeological fieldwork. The selection committee will assess both academic accomplishments and financial need during their evaluation. The application window spans from winter through to the specified due date.

AIA scholarships welcome students from diverse backgrounds, with a particular encouragement for minority and disadvantaged students to apply.
